This volume contains a set of chapters which provide an Australian perspective on issues such as archaeological significance, cultural landscapes, the interpretation ofmaterial objects, the role of education and cultural sovereignty. The other aim is to provide a series of readings, for students enrolled in archaeological and/or cultural heritage management courses, that deal with conceptual rather than technical issues in cultural resource management.
